Garlic Roasted Cherry Tomatoes

An easy and flavorful dish made with cherry tomatoes, garlic, and olive oil, perfect as a side or topping for various meals.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Course Appetizer, Side Dish
Cuisine Mediterranean
Servings 4 servings
Calories 120 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 2 pints cherry tomatoes Choose ripe and juicy tomatoes for the best flavor.
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ced Fresh garlic adds depth of flavor.
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il Vital for roasting; don’t skimp on this.
  • to taste salt Adjust to your preference.
  • to taste pepper Adjust to your preference.
  • 1 teaspoon chili flakes Optional for a spicy kick.
  • to garnish fresh basil or parsley For garnish before serving.

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
  • Rinse the cherry tomatoes under cold water and pat them dry.
  • In a mixing bowl, combine the tomatoes, minced garlic, olive oil, salt, pepper, and chili flakes. Toss gently until the tomatoes are evenly coated.
  •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Spread the tomatoes in a single layer across the baking sheet.

Cooking

  • Roast the tomatoes in the preheated oven for about 20–25 minutes, until soft and slightly caramelized.

Serving

  • Remove from the oven and garnish with fresh basil or parsley. Serve warm.

Notes

Experiment with different herbs and cheeses.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to a week, or freeze for later use.
